Detailed Call Description

The Erasmus Charter for Higher Education (ECHE) is an EU quality certificate for higher education institutions (HEIs). It is a prerequisite for all HEIs from Erasmus+ Programme countries to apply for funding under Erasmus+ calls (including calls managed by Erasmus+ National Agencies). By applying for the ECHE, the HEI confirms that its participation in Erasmus+ is part of its strategy for modernisation and internationalisation. This strategy acknowledges the key contribution of student and staff mobility and of participation in transnational cooperation projects, to the quality of its higher education programmes and student experience.
The ECHE aims to reinforce the quality of student and staff mobility, as well as of cooperation projects.

The ECHE will be valid for the entire duration of the Erasmus+ Programme 2021-2027 (and up until the end of projects funded under that Programme). The award of the ECHE does not automatically imply any direct funding under the Erasmus+ Programme.
ECHE holders will be subject to regular monitoring by the National Agencies.

Eligibility For Participation Notes

In order to be eligible, the applicants must:

  • be higher education institution (HEI) (public or private) and
  • be established in one of the eligible countries, i.e.:
    • Erasmus+ Programme Countries:
      • EU Member States (including overseas countries and territories (OCTs)
      • non-EU countries:
        • listed EEA (European Economic Area) countries and countries associated to the Erasmus+ Programme (associated countries) or countries which are in ongoing negotiations for an association agreement and where the agreement enters into force before certification award.
        • Western Balkans third countries not associated to the Erasmus+ Programme: Albania, Bosnia and Herzegovina, Kosovo and Montenegro.

Higher education institutions (HEIs) — are institutions which offer recognised degrees or other tertiary level qualifications and other comparable institutions at tertiary level, if recognised by the national authorities. The applicant must be recognised as higher education institution by the national authority of its country. After closure of the call, the national authorities will be asked by EACEA to confirm that they are recognised in their countries.

Countries currently negotiating association agreements — Beneficiaries from countries with ongoing negotiations (see list above) may participate in the call and can be awarded the Charter if the negotiations are concluded.
